The X cam is not at all right for that combo. I think the heads stop flowing at .500", so what good is a cam with .542 lift? In any case it's not going to be well matched to the combo. If you had to have a motorsport cam, I'd sell the X and buy an E.

Quick search brought up this...

The 2031 cam profile was designed for the GT40 head. Reason I know this, is when I rebuilt my old 92 LX that had a Cobra Top End I wanted a cam that would match the heads that I had sent out to be ported.

After researching cams, I called Crane and was told the best cam for the 1993-1995 Cobra was the Powermax 2031.

The cam is a proven cam.

12.70 @ 107.83

281 rwhp @ 5400 rpm
317 ft-lbs @ 4000rpm


Pro-M 75mm
65mm TB
Edelbrock Performer
GT40 Iron Heads
Crane 2031
3.73's

a b303 cam with 1.7 rockers or a steeda #18 will make the most power due to the added duration. I had pheads,b303cam, stock shortblock, cobra intake, full exhaust, pulleys, tbody, 24lb inj, c&l maf and bbk cai my car made 275/316 if i remember correctly and that was with stock rockers id say i wouldve been closer to the 285-290 mark with 1.7s
